A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the cause of your windows not closing properly. This problem can not only cause draughts but can also lead to water damage and damp. To check this, you can try placing a piece of paper between the sash and the frame to see if it is able to be closed.

To repair it, you'll have to take off the seals around the frame and the sash. Then, you will need to remove the locking gearbox from its place inside the frame. This requires the aid of a tool, like a flat screwdriver and a torch to reach the gearbox.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one that is the same model and size.
